The Celestia price is at risk of a 30% crash with its $890 million token unlock. Tokenomist data showed that 176.2 million tokens were unlocked in the Celestia ecosystem, representing 80% of its circulating supply. This unlock is set to cause a supply shock which could negatively impact the Celestia price.
117.38 million of these unlocked TIA tokens were allocated to private investors who could easily sell off their holdings to secure profits, causing the Celestia price to decline. As Tokenomist noted, these token unlocks have potential implications and could spark future market volatility, which is why Whales are currently bearish about the Celestia price.
